Subject: Handover — report builder sorting

Hi, taking over from tonight's shift: the Quillboard report builder has an unstable sort on grouped columns, so exports can reorder between runs. Fix is merged but gated behind the release flag. Nothing user-facing broke yet. If the release manager needs sign-off details before cutover, contact the team inbox.

escalation mailbox, bafog-fafog: ulador@paliqlabs.internal

## Deploying the Gatewick Proctor Queue

Deploys are pretty painless: push to main, wait for the pipeline, then watch the queue drain dashboard for five minutes. If candidates pile up mid-exam, roll back first and ask questions later — the queue replays safely. Everything the workers care about lives in one config block, shown here for reference.

settings of bafof-yagef:
JOROX_PIN=8740
JOROX_TENANT=pelox
JOROX_METRICS_HOST=metrics.jorox.qorvelworks.internal
JOROX_SEAL=seal_c78f63c1
JOROX_STANDBY_TEAM=norax

**Runbook: Cold starts — Fernwick serverless handlers**

Symptom: p99 latency spikes after idle periods or deploys. Check the warmer job first; it pings each handler every four minutes. If warmers are healthy, inspect bundle size — anything over the threshold triples init time. Do not raise memory limits as a workaround. Thresholds, warmer config, and escalation steps are documented here.

wiki page, tahaf-tajog: https://jira.ordindyn.corp/pipeline

//
// Tuned against the March evaluation corpus gathered from Verdane Press
// catalog queries. Raising this above 2.4 caused short navigational
// queries to bury exact SKU matches; lowering it below 1.6 let stale
// descriptions outrank fresh titles. The 1.9 value balanced NDCG@10
// across both query classes. Do not change without re-running the
// offline harness and the shadow-traffic check. The harness stamps each
// tuning run, and the reference token appears below.
const RELEVANCE_TITLE_BOOST = 1.9;

pipeline stamp: htk3_cc5